Output 89fd356beb1e9e149d4e68a2c09d18bc50cea894e88744ad3f28a56263569bca:3

value
668112
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ec33afbf245649067bfadb1608f6e033999d60d80df5b3005dd584c1773f97c0
address
bc1pase6l0ey2eysv7l6mvtq3ahqxwve6cxcph6mxqza6kzvzaeljlqqmh09wq
transaction
89fd356beb1e9e149d4e68a2c09d18bc50cea894e88744ad3f28a56263569bca
confirmations
49719
spent
true